Small Towns, Farmers See Benefits From Rail Improvements

PIERRE — Economic development is a main driver behind a bill that would appropriate up to 20-million dollars to help upgrade the Pierre to Rapid City subdivision of the Rapid City, Pierre and Eastern main line.
